#067458 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#067458 is composed of 2.4% red, 45.5%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.1%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 164.7 degrees, a saturation of 90.2% and a lightness of 23.9%. #067458 color hex could be obtained by blending #0ce8b0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#067458 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#067458 has RGB values of R:6, G:116,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 423000.

Shades and Tints of #067458
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000403 is the darkest color, while #f0fef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#067458
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3a403f is the less saturated color, while #01795a is the most saturated one.
